
PC 300 G4ME headset from Sennheiser Communications
By: Peter Chubb | August 10, 2009 | 1 CommentWhen it comes to headphones and headsets, one of the best on the market is Sennheiser Communications. They have just added to their ever-expanding range with the PC 300 G4ME headset, which has been created for the use with laptops and PCs for online gaming as well as online chat.
According to Electronista, these new portable headphones have a light-weight in-ear design which helps to reduce noise. The PC 300 G4ME headset also comes with an integrated microphone and in-line volume control, making it easy for you to change the volume to the perfect setting.
This latest headset is made from the same capsules as the Sennheiser CX 300-II ear-canal phones. There is a choice of three different sized silicone ear-sleeves, making it easy to get the perfect fit. The headphones come with standard 3.5mm plugs, which plugs into your computers soundcard.
The new Sennheiser Communications PC 300 G4ME headset costs around $170.
